Abstract
Przedmiotem zgłoszenia jest kompozycja do wytwarzania sztywnej pianki poliuretanowej o poprawionych właściwościach hydrofobowych, na bazie poliolu, która zawiera oprócz poliolu 4,4'-diizocyjanian difenylometanu, katalizator, zmodyfikowany napełniacz pochodzenia roślinnego w postaci zmielonych pestek śliwki, zmodyfikowanych przez dodanie 3-izocyjanianopropylotrietoksysilanu, a nadto zawiera środek powierzchniowo-czynny, wodę oraz mieszaninę pentanu i cyklopentanu o stosunku wagowym składników 1:1.The subject of the application is a composition for the production of a rigid polyurethane foam with improved hydrophobic properties, based on a polyol, which contains, apart from the polyol, 4,4'-diphenylmethane diisocyanate, a catalyst, a modified filler of plant origin in the form of ground plum stones, modified by adding 3-isocyanatopropyltriethoxysilane, and moreover, it contains a surfactant, water and a mixture of pentane and cyclopentane with a 1:1 ratio by weight of the components.
